Single bunk beds

It's a great way to make room in your child’s bedroom, and it allows them to share their room with an older sibling. It also helps them learn to stay close and bond as they grow. Bunk beds are available in a variety of designs and sizes to meet your family's needs.

Before you purchase a bunk bed, consider the dimensions of the room as well as the height of your child to be sure that they will be comfortable. You should also consider the design of the ladder whether it's straight or slanting and how well your child will be able to climb. In addition you must also look for bunk beds that have enough space between the beds for your child to be able to sit in bed comfortably.

Storage beds

A bed with storage is a great option when you live in a small space or wish to reduce clutter. They come with compartments or drawers that hold everything from clothes to toys to small knick-knacks. You can choose between shallow or deep drawers based on the size of your space.

A storage bed is also an excellent option for a room for kids, since it provides ample space to store clothes and other things. It will also make it easier to get your child dressed for school the next morning by keeping their room tidy.
